WebSolarization is the process of placing a clear plastic tarp over a field, garden bed or lawn to heat up the soil underneath. The intention of solarization is to kill weeds or grass, though it can have added benefits of reducing pathogen populations in the soil. WebApr 9, 2024 · This is particularly important when the soil can quickly dry out in hot and dry weather. Mulch helps to conserve water and keep the soil moist, reducing the frequency of watering your plants. 2. Prevents Soil Erosion. Another important benefit of using mulch in your garden is that it helps to prevent soil erosion. It can be used in raised beds, in-ground, and container gardening and will help with aeration and drainage. Vermiculite can be mixed with your garden, raised bed or container soil at a ratio of ⅓ to ½ .
